Annie-Claude and Jean-Claude Guillou, laureates of the "Etoiles de l'Acceuil des Pays de la Loire", welcome you to their elegant and comfortable 19th century mansion situated on the hills around the village, which is classed as a "Petite Cité de Caractère" (small picturesque village), and affords magnificent views of the valley. It has a 3 hectare park, a French garden, a small wildlife park and a guided nature trail through the estate's 200 different species of trees. As a matter of curiosity, Kota Cabana is also a luxurious tree cabin in the centenary trees of the park, at a height of 7.7 metres and constructed in Finland. You reach it by a spiral staircase.
